Black White And Pink Wedding Cakes
There are many brides out there who are madly in love with the pink color and the idea of having a pink wedding theme. But a bride must realize that she is not alone on her wedding day and that the groom’s tastes are a bit different and do not include pink.
Well, when dealing with this situation a pink lover bride must think of creative and ingenious ways to incorporate pink into a more classic and cold color scheme, where pink will only come out in small accents and create a more romantic, lovely and feminine appearance. When it comes to wedding cakes, pink might be a little too exaggerated if one is using this Barbie color too excessive.

So, to avoid any unwanted and unpleasing situations one can decide to go with a black white and pink wedding cake. It might be the most appropriated choice for those of you who wish to bring a splash of color and romanticism to the big wedding cake. A black and white theme might be a bit too boring, classical, formal and simple for a couple’s taste and vision of a wedding day and so adding tiny accents of pink might just save the day
A black white and pink wedding cake is also perfect for those brides and grooms who want to have a semi-formal wedding day, not too rigorous and serious and not too funny and colorful. And a black white and pink wedding cake can offer you precisely this unique and inspired combination between a touch of traditional and modern.

The result is actually stunning and more impressive than you could ever imagine. One can use fresh and natural pink flowers to decorate and embellish a black and white wedding cake, such as roses, peonies, tulips, orchids, daises, gladiolas, calla lilies or any other matching type of flower.
For a more realistic, dramatic and artistic black white and pink wedding cake one can use edible pink flowers, scattered into the layers of the cake.
